Update for Samoa:


Samoa measles outbreak worsens with death toll reaching 22
https://www.bbc.com/news/world-asia-50528834

A measles outbreak in the Pacific nation of Samoa has killed 22 people, nearly all children under five.

The government says 1,797 cases have been reported - 153 since Friday alone.

Samoa declared a state of emergency last week to combat the outbreak. All schools are closed, children under 17 are banned from public gatherings and vaccinations are now compulsory.

Update for Samoa:

Samoa measles epidemic worsens with 24 children now dead
https://www.nbcnews.com/health/kids-health/samoa-measles-epidemic-worsens-24-children-now-dead-n1090551

WELLINGTON, New Zealand — Authorities said Monday that a measles epidemic sweeping through Samoa continues to worsen with the death toll rising to 25, all but one of them young children.

“We still have a big problem at hand,” Samoa’s Director General of Health Leausa Take Naseri said in a video statement.

He said more than 140 new cases of people contracting the virus had been recorded within the past day, bringing the total to about 2,200 cases since the outbreak began last month. He said there are about 20 critically ill children who remain in hospital intensive care units.

More E. coli illnesses linked to Salinas romaine lettuce, CDC says 67 people in 19 states ill

https://www.usatoday.com/story/money/food/2019/11/26/salinas-calif-romaine-lettuce-linked-more-illnesses-cdc-says/4313197002/

An additional 27 people have been infected with a strain of E. coli linked to romaine lettuce, the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ention said Tuesday.

Days after announcing the outbreak and issuing a safety alert for lettuce harvested in Salinas, California, the CDC released an update saying 67 people have been sick from 19 states.

This is up from 40 people from 16 states in the Nov. 22 advisory.

UN says armed attacks in eastern Congo kill Ebola responders
https://abcnews.go.com/Health/wireStory/armed-attacks-eastern-congo-kill-ebola-responders-67365243?cid=clicksource_4380645_null_headlines_hed

Armed groups have attacked and killed Ebola response workers in eastern Congo, the World Health Organization chief said Thursday, an alarming development that could cause the waning outbreak to again pick up momentum.

“We are heartbroken that our worst fears have been realized,” Tedros Adhanom Ghebreyesus said on Twitter. He did not say how many people were killed in the attacks in Biakato Mines and Mangina. Others were wounded, he said.

Yet another case of the plague was just discovered
https://bgr.com/2019/11/28/plague-in-china-bubonic-pneumonic/

A fourth person in China is now confirmed to have the plague. A farmworker in Inner Mongolia tested positive for the disease and is now under strict quarantine as health officials monitor his condition.
As AFP reports, the man is said to be in stable condition. The man’s diagnosis comes on the heels of a trio of other plague cases in the country. China is reportedly responding with a new extermination campaign, spraying hundreds of acres of land with poison to kill off rats and fleas which may be acting as carriers of the disease.

Samoan Government To Close Its Offices Amid Measles Crisis That Has Left 53 Dead :-)

https://www.npr.org/2019/12/02/784179707/samoan-government-to-close-its-offices-amid-measles-crisis-that-has-left-53-dead

The Pacific island nation of Samoa will shut down government services for two days so that civil servants can focus on a nationwide immunization drive as the country struggles to end a measles outbreak that has claimed more than 50 lives, most of them children.

Prime Minister Tuilaepa Sailele Malielegaoi announced the closure on Monday, saying the government is relying on "village councils, faith-based organizations, and church leaders, village mayors and government women representatives" to persuade the public to get vaccinated. As a result, he said, all but public utility government services will be shuttered Dec. 5 and 6.

Flu season arrives early, driven by an unexpected virus

https://www.cnbc.com/2019/12/06/us-flu-season-arrives-early-driven-by-an-unexpected-virus.html

The U.S. winter flu season is off to its earliest start in more than 15 years.

An early barrage of illness in the South has begun to spread more broadly, and there’s a decent chance flu season could peak much earlier than normal, health officials say.

The last flu season to rev up this early was in 2003-2004 — a bad one. Some experts think the early start may mean a lot of suffering is in store, but others say it’s too early to tell.

Minister: Polio virus probably brought in from outside Malaysia
https://www.malaymail.com/news/malaysia/2019/12/09/minister-polio-virus-probably-brought-in-from-outside-malaysia/1817658

PUTRAJAYA, Dec 9 — The polio virus which infected a three-month-old Malaysian boy from Tuaran, Sabah is suspected to have come from outside Sabah, said Health Minister Datuk Seri Dzulkefly Ahmad.

He said there were two possibilities how the polio virus, which had been eradicated 27 years ago, could reappear in the country — either the virus came from the Philippines or the infant’s family had travelled abroad.

However, according to initial investigation, the infant’s family members did no travel overseas.

Check your fridge: 88 egg products under recall after deadly listeria outbreak
Posted 10:01 AM, December 24, 2019

Multiple brands of products that include hard-boiled eggs are under nationwide recall following an alert last week by the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ention about a deadly outbreak of listeria. At least seven people in five states have gotten sick, including one who died in Texas.

The eggs from Almark Foods of Gainesville, Ga., were sent to foodservice operators nationwide. Almark says it has temporarily suspended all production at its Gainesville plant.

Trader Joe’s announced Monday it is recalling its brand name Egg Salad in 6-ounce cups and its brand name Old Fashioned Potato Salada in 20-ounc trays. They have use-by dates up to and including Dec. 27, 2019.

Almark Foods has announced a recall of 76 items distributed nationwide. They were sold under multiple brand names including 7 Select, Almark Foods, Best Choice, CMI, Dairy Fresh, Deb-El, Egglands Best, Everyday Essentials, Farmers Hen House, Food Club, Fresh Thyme, Giant Eagle, Great Day, Great Value, Inspired Organics, Kirkland Signature, Kroger, LIDL, Lucerne, Members Mark, Naturally Better, Nellie’s, O Organics, Peckish, Pete & Gerry’s, Rainbow Farms, Rembrandt Foods, ShopRite, Simple Truth Organics, Sunshine, Vital Farms, and Wild Harvest.

The Almark recall includes all product packaged for the retail market manufactured at its Gainesville plant that remains within shelf life. This includes product with “Best If Used By” dates up through March 2, 2020.

China launches probe into mysterious viral pneumonia amid rumors of SARS 2.0
https://www.rt.com/news/477163-china-probes-viral-pneumonia-outbreak/

Dozens of patients have been quarantined and several hospitals put on alert in central China amid an outbreak of a viral pneumonia of unknown origin.

There have been a total of 27 confirmed cases since the start of December in Wuhan, with the majority appearing to come from a single seafood market in the city. Health workers are still working to pinpoint the source, while also disinfecting the marketplace as a precaution.

Seven patients are critically ill, 18 others are in stable condition, and two are recovering and are expected to be released shortly, according to the Wuhan health department. So far no human-to-human infection has taken place and no medical staff have contracted the illness.

Wuhan pneumonia: six more cases in Hong Kong take total to more than 50 but professor says risk of spread during Lunar New Year mass migration unlikely

https://www.scmp.com/news/hong-kong/health-environment/article/3045622/wuhan-pneumonia-six-more-cases-hong-kong-take


Six more people have been admitted to hospitals in Hong Kong after developing respiratory symptoms on their return from the mainland Chinese city of Wuhan, health authorities said on Friday.

It brought the number of suspected cases in the city to 54.

A new coronavirus strain was revealed by mainland health authorities on Thursday to be the cause of the mystery pneumonia outbreak in the central Chinese city, where 59 people have been infected since December.
